19768328
0xf70618244a66350bed1558c5aaf6d81e931677bd2f123d4137d9590380e428f2
Transactions11
Height19768328
Confirmations2242842
Timestamp349 days 3 hours ago
Size (bytes)1825
Version
Merkle Root
Nonce0x28460e6025ccc973
Bits
Difficulty0x7d1f7e6ddec27

Transactions

mined 349 days 3 hours ago
Transfer (0xa9059cbb)
ERC20 Token Transfers